- Abstract:
- Abstract : The Debus–Radziszewski reaction is used for the one‐pot synthesis of main‐chain imidazolium‐containing polymers from simple organic compounds. This paper finds that via anion‐metathesis reaction to replace the acetate anion with dicyanamide, the thermal properties of the main‐chain polyimidazoliums are improved and one of these polyimidazoliums presents an unusually high carbonization yield of up to 66 wt% at 900 °C. Abstract : This paper reports on the one‐pot synthesis of main‐chain imidazolium‐containing polymers, some of which show unusually high thermal stability. The imidazolium polymers are obtained by modified Debus–Radziszewski reactions for the chain build‐up from simple organic compounds, here pyruvaldehyde, formaldehyde, acetic acid, and a variety of diamines. The reactions are performed in aqueous media at ambient conditions, being synthetically elegant, convenient, and highly efficient. Finally, a simple anion‐metathesis reaction is conducted to replace the acetate anion with dicyanamide, and the thermal properties of the main‐chain polyimidazoliums before and after anion exchange are studied in detail, which demonstrate chain cross‐linking by the counterion and a coupled unusually high carbonization yield of up to 66 wt% at 900 °C.
